From 8d8ae7dfc00a3209b2c3ec4eab6de9dfc5be3fe7 Mon Sep 17 00:00:00 2001 From: Terry Jia Date: Mon, 13 Jul 2026 09:50:30 -0400 Subject: [PATCH] feat: share one WebGL context across all 3D views (#13547)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it ## Summary Browsers cap live WebGL contexts per page, so each Load3D node owning its own renderer broke once enough 3D nodes were added. All 3D views now share a single offscreen WebGLRenderer: each view renders into the bottom-left region of the shared drawing buffer and blits the frame into its own plain 2D canvas, which has no context limit. - Add sharedWebGLRenderer (refcounted singleton, grow-only buffer) and RendererView (per-view canvas + per-view renderer state + blit) - Per-view renderer state (tone mapping, color space, clear color) is applied before each view renders; HDRIManager and SceneModelManager write to it instead of the renderer - OrbitControls/TransformControls bind to the node container explicitly - ViewHelperManager renders the axes helper itself so it can position and scale independently of renderer DOM layout - RecordingManager records from the view canvas; capture renders at exact size on the shared buffer as before - On last view release the context is force-lost and webglcontextlost is dispatched synchronously so context-loss handlers still run ## Screenshots (if applicable) before image
